About Boone Electric Cooperative
Boone Electric Cooperative is an electricity cooperative operating in Missouri, including cities like Columbia, Ashland, Centralia, Hallsville, and Sturgeon. Recently, the company reported a customer base of 34,266 accounts, 32,968 of which are residential properties, 1,291 are commercial customer accounts and 7 are industrial accounts. The residential electricity rate for patrons of Boone Electric Cooperative is, on average, 11.65 cents per kilowatt hour, resulting in the supplier ranking 52nd out of 127 suppliers in Missouri and 852nd out of 2893 in the country. In 2022 the company had retail sales of 594,867 megawatt hours. The electricity they sourced consisted of megawatt hours that they procured on the wholesale market. They purchased 621,693 on the wholesale market. Their revenue for 2022 from electricity related activities was $66,750,000, with $66,089,000 from retail sales to end users.
Patrons of the supplier pay an average residential electricity bill of $132.09. This is 0.84% less than the national average of $133.21. The supplier is not associated with any power facilities and all of the electricity that they sell to their customers must be purchased from other providers.
Consumers of Boone Electric Cooperative have the ability to use net metering. This is a positive for any customer considering installing private solar panels, as net metering allows them to sell their excess megawatt hours back into the grid.
Energy loss is always a consideration when dealing with electricity transmission. Boone Electric Cooperative currently averages a loss of approximately 4.23% of the electricity they transmit. The state of Missouri has an energy loss average of 3.23% and the US average is 2.87%, giving Boone Electric Cooperative a rank of 679th best out of 3517 providers who report energy loss in the nation.
